mirror of
https://github.com/minio/minio.git
synced 2025-11-23 11:07:50 -05:00
Add numeric/date policy conditions (#9233)
add new policy conditions - NumericEquals - NumericNotEquals - NumericLessThan - NumericLessThanEquals - NumericGreaterThan - NumericGreaterThanEquals - DateEquals - DateNotEquals - DateLessThan - DateLessThanEquals - DateGreaterThan - DateGreaterThanEquals
This commit is contained in:
@@ -106,6 +106,18 @@ var conditionFuncMap = map[name]func(Key, ValueSet) (Function, error){
|
||||
notIPAddress: newNotIPAddressFunc,
|
||||
null: newNullFunc,
|
||||
boolean: newBooleanFunc,
|
||||
numericEquals: newNumericEqualsFunc,
|
||||
numericNotEquals: newNumericNotEqualsFunc,
|
||||
numericLessThan: newNumericLessThanFunc,
|
||||
numericLessThanEquals: newNumericLessThanEqualsFunc,
|
||||
numericGreaterThan: newNumericGreaterThanFunc,
|
||||
numericGreaterThanEquals: newNumericGreaterThanEqualsFunc,
|
||||
dateEquals: newDateEqualsFunc,
|
||||
dateNotEquals: newDateNotEqualsFunc,
|
||||
dateLessThan: newDateLessThanFunc,
|
||||
dateLessThanEquals: newDateLessThanEqualsFunc,
|
||||
dateGreaterThan: newDateGreaterThanFunc,
|
||||
dateGreaterThanEquals: newDateGreaterThanEqualsFunc,
|
||||
// Add new conditions here.
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user